Git 怎样在WSL2上将Meld用作Git的合并工具和差异工具
在本文中,我们将介绍如何在Windows Subsystem for Linux 2 (WSL2)环境中将Meld用作Git的合并工具和差异工具。Git是一款强大的版本控制工具,它在开发中起着至关重要的作用。Meld是一种直观易用的图形化工具,它可以帮助我们解决Git中的冲突并进行差异比较。
阅读更多:Git 教程
步骤1:安装Meld
第一步是在WSL2中安装Meld。在终端中执行以下命令:
这些命令将更新软件包列表并安装Meld工具。
步骤2:配置Git
接下来,我们需要对Git进行配置,以便使用Meld作为合并工具和差异工具。在终端中执行以下命令:
这些命令将将Git的合并工具和差异工具配置为Meld。
步骤3:使用Meld进行合并
现在,我们可以使用Meld来解决Git冲突。假设我们有一个名为”mybranch”的分支,并且我们想要将它合并到”master”分支上。
如果在合并过程中发生冲突,Git会将冲突的文件标记为未解决状态,并在终端中显示如何解决冲突的提示。我们可以使用以下命令打开Meld图形界面来解决冲突:
Meld将显示冲突文件的三个版本:当前分支的版本,要合并的分支的版本和基本版本。我们可以通过编辑文件,选择要保留的更改,并解决冲突。
步骤4:使用Meld进行差异比较
除了解决冲突外,我们还可以使用Meld工具进行差异比较。假设我们想要比较”mybranch”分支和”master”分支之间的差异。
这将在终端中显示差异的详细信息。要使用Meld进行差异比较,我们可以执行以下命令:
Meld将打开一个图形界面,显示两个分支之间的差异内容。我们可以使用Meld的直观界面来查看并比较文件的不同之处。
总结
本文介绍了如何在WSL2上将Meld用作Git的合并工具和差异工具。通过安装Meld并配置Git,我们可以使用Meld解决冲突并比较差异。Meld的直观界面使得解决冲突和查看差异变得更加简单明了。希望本文对您理解如何使用Meld提升Git使用体验有所帮助。